Account Recovery — Pagewright Static Builds

If a customer loses access to their Pagewright dashboard, incremental rebuilds of their static site will continue from the last known-good deploy, so no content is lost during recovery. Confirm the customer's last rebuild timestamp in the Orlin console, then initiate the recovery flow from the admin panel. Do not trigger a full rebuild until access is restored. Unlocking the recovery flow requires the passphrase below.

recovery phrase for yadup-taguf: wenael-quenox-kelix

## Configuration

Tracewick propagates request context across all Lanternhook microservices via signed trace headers. For review purposes, note that sampling rate, redaction rules, and span retention are each set independently in the service env file; none default to permissive values. Header signing is mandatory in every environment, including local. The signing material is supplied by the following env entry, placed directly after the sampling block.

sealed setting: ARCHIVE_KEY3=8d0

## Action Item REL-12: Image slimming

The Bramblecart deploy exceeded the registry quota because our base images carried full toolchains into production. Remediation: adopt multi-stage builds, strip debug symbols, and enforce size gates in the release pipeline. Release manager owns enforcement starting next cycle. The gate thresholds the pipeline will apply are as follows.

constants for fajop-tahaf:
RATE_LIMITS = {
    "holael": 2,
    "oliael": 10,
    "druael": 10,
    "wenwyn": 10,
}